Hangnyeoul Station is a station on the Seoul Subway Line 3. The only exit of this station is connected to SETEC (Seoul Trade Exhibition & Convention Center). This station has the least ridership of all Line 3 stations in Seoul.
It is located in Daechi-dong, Gangnam-gu, Seoul.
